Review of Ego 28" SNT2807 Snow Blower (versus Toro 28" 828LXE) in Central, WI
This year, I completed my transition from Toro gas-powered products to Ego, as I had started the transition several years ago. I currently have from Ego: 21" mower, 22" aluminum deck mower, 42" Z6 riding mower, leaf blower, trimmer, edger, chainsaw, snow blower, shop vac, portable light, and maybe some other items. 18 years ago, I purchased the Toro snow blower. Overall, it was a heavy beast. At times, it was difficult to start, but after I got the hang of it (or used electric start), it served me well for many winters in Central Wisconsin (Plover). I recently gave it away to a coworker where it'll continue working well for many winters to come. A couple of months ago, I purchased the Ego snow blower and hoped it would work well, given that I no longer had the Toro! Last night, we got around 6-10" (drifts in certain areas). I fired up the snow blower this morning and I have to say, it is AWESOME, as every product I've used from Ego is. They really think through their designs. Even though it wasn't a ton of snow, it was impressive how much power the snow blower has and how far it can throw. Also, it is significantly quieter than the Toro, and of course, no gas fumes! It's also nice that when stepping away to shovel or do something else, it is silent (effectively "off"). I can't wait for the next snow--hopefully deeper. I couldn't be happier with this snow blower and highly recommend it and every other Ego item I've ever purchased. I used around 40% of the (2-12 amp hour) batteries, putzing around a lot in the road to clear where the plow went through. For reference, my driveway would hold perhaps 7.5 vehicles. I bet I can get it done with 20-30% of the battery next time. Ego power shovel honest review March 3 2025
You want the fast answer? It's not worth it. Don't buy it! Juicy story: The day before, it rained and snowed as Minnesota's weather does. Temps were around 30s-40s Fahrenheit. I figured all that snow might freeze overnight (at the very bottom at least) possibly or end up really heavy at least. We had a reported 4 inches of snow. I was going to buy a power shovel for this good limit testing day. As I walked out the snow was up to 1-4 inches from my knees (I'm 5'9"). So I bought the ego shovel with the kit (battery and charger). And went to work. Out the box the unit without the battery feels very nice. With the battery it feels like it adds 5 pounds when you're actually working with it (mind you I had to pull the shovel up to my knees to process the heavy wet packed yet fluffy on the top snow). The only good thing was how fast the battery charged. Doing that heavy packed wet snow it took a bar and a half battery life. (Only charged the battery for 15 minutes and it got to 2 solid bars and the 3rd bar was flashing, mind you the battery was already at 1 solid bar) End of the story, a lightweight shovel will outperform this weak monster by 3 times. The only upsides for the ego unit is the directional plow, and charging speed, and finally it does help your lower back. No pain at all. But my shoulder and arms started burning because the snow was literally that bad. Wet snow packed but fluffy on the outside felt like a soft but frozen ice cream on the inside. In conclusion, there is no performance upsides, the unit spins too slow and the blades are ineffective against this kind of snow. Scenario consumer: I wanted a power shovel that wasn't heavy and not as expensive as a snowblower because I don't have much to snow. But on days it does snow, it'll hurt your back enough to consider buying some tool to help. I also wanted a power shovel that had a directional blow you could manually control (ego being the only one as of this moment). I had high expectations to perform well with this thing. It was not worth the 329 dollars to get this. I did enjoy setting it up though because it was easy like eating pie with a fork. But yeah, not worth it. Don't buy, I suggest waiting for the market to come up with better power shovels, or for Toro to come up with a better power snow shovel that can control blow direction. If you don't live in close proximity to your neighbors, I'd suggest the current Toro because judging from video reviews it will eat some types of snow/ice. Update: Get the power shovel for more light snow, bring out the 2 stage for really heavy packed wet snow. Thank you for your knowledge, considerations, and help.
